Common DoorKing Gate Repair Problems We Solve in Placentia

  • Santa Ana wind fatigue on 6100 Series swing arms. The 6100 operator’s welded hinge bracket takes direct lateral load when Santa Ana winds channel through Carbon Canyon at 60-plus mph. We’ve seen the arm weld itself to the pin after years of corrosion flex cycling. We cut the seized assembly, fabricate a new stainless bracket to match your original iron profile, and powder-coat it RAL 9005 black.
  • Conductive dust film on 1830 Series control boards. Placentia’s dry Santa Ana conditions create a fine, electrically conductive dust layer on 1830 slide operator terminals. Mixed with HOA landscape debris, it causes intermittent shorts that mimic board failure. We clean, test, and only replace the board if it’s genuinely fried.
  • Gearbox seizure on 6300 Series operators. These units went into thousands of Placentia tract homes built between 1975 and 1995. After 30-plus years of inland heat cycles, the sealed lubricant in the 6300 gearbox turns to varnish. We can source OEM gearboxes or, in some cases, rebuild the housing with fresh seals and lubricant.
  • Gate frame sag on 9200 Series slide operators. The 9200 is a solid residential slide gate motor, but it’s often mounted to 1970s concrete footings that weren’t sized for decades of wet-dry soil expansion. We re-anchor posts with helical piers when needed, then realign the track so the 9200 doesn’t overwork itself to failure.
  • Rust-jacked hinge pins on period ironwork. Original wrought-iron gates in Placentia’s older tracts have hinge pins that haven’t seen maintenance since the Carter administration. The pin swells, cracks the surrounding scrollwork, and binds the operator. We extract the pin, weld repair the scroll detail, and bush the hinge to correct alignment.

DoorKing Service in Placentia: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ment

Placentia’s 1970s tract homes in the 92870 zip frequently have original wrought-iron gates with custom scrollwork that was welded on-site during original construction. Those gates weren’t catalog items. Each HOA tract had slight variations in picket spacing, scroll pattern, and finial design, installed by local ironworkers who bent and welded stock on the property. Forty to fifty years later, that custom work creates a repair problem no parts warehouse can solve.

When a DoorKing 6100 or 6300 operator fails on one of these gates, the fix isn’t always in the motor. Often it’s the hinge bracket that cracked because Santa Ana winds flexed a corroded pin against a half-century of rust. An off-the-shelf aluminum hinge from a catalog won’t match the original profile. The HOA will reject it. We’ve been turned away by Placentia HOAs ourselves when previous technicians tried exactly that shortcut.

So our techs carry a mobile welding rig. We grind, repair, and repaint scroll details to match what was originally installed. That skill set is unnecessary in cities with standard catalog gates. DoorKing Models & Products We Service in Placentia

We maintain full service capability across DoorKing’s core residential and light-commercial lines: the 6100 and 6300 Series swing gate operators, the 1830 and 1838 Series commercial slide gates, the 9200 Series residential slide gate operators, and the 9300 Series retrofit intercom kits.

Our parts approach splits by component type. For electronic components — motors, control boards, limit switches, and safety sensors — we use OEM DoorKing parts. Compatibility is non-negotiable when a 1830 board needs to talk to a specific photocell protocol. For structural components, we fabricate in-house. Custom steel hinge brackets, weld patches for rusted frames, and post reinforcement plates are cut and welded on your property, because many Placentia HOAs demand original aesthetics that aftermarket catalog parts cannot match.

We stock common DoorKing electronic failure items for fast Placentia turnaround. Boards for the 1830 and 9200 series, 6100/6300 arm assemblies, and gear motor replacements are typically available same-day or next-day. DoorKing Service Pricing in Placentia

DoorKing repair costs in Placentia typically fall into these ranges based on what we’ve billed across 17 years of gate-only work:

  • Diagnostic and minor adjustment: $125–$180 (hinge lubrication, limit switch calibration, safety sensor realignment)
  • Electronic component replacement: $280–$650 (OEM control board, gear motor, or intercom module, including labor)
  • Weld repair and structural fabrication: $340–$890 (custom hinge bracket, frame reinforcement, rust treatment and repainting)
  • Post re-anchoring with helical piers: $580–$1,200 (required when 1970s footings have shifted)
  • Full operator replacement with structural prep: $1,400–$2,800 (includes removal, new 6100/6300/9200 unit, and mounting surface restoration)

What drives cost upward: rusted fasteners that require cutting instead of unbolting, concealed frame cracks that expand once exposed, and HOA-mandated finish matching that adds powder-coating time. What keeps cost down: catching hinge wear before it cracks the scrollwork, and addressing track misalignment before it burns out the gear motor.
